前言
Appium是一个开源的移动应用自动化测试框架,它允许开发人员使用多种编程语言(包括Python)来编写自动化测试脚本。Appium框架提供了一套API和工具,可以与移动设备进行通信,并模拟用户在移动应用上的操作。
流程
1.打开 appium server
 2.获取当前手机的 device Name 和 安卓版本号,打开 driver
 3.运行 case
 4.生成报告
 5.关闭 driver
 6.关闭 appium server

具体说说 run.py
整个程序是从这个模块开始运行的,也是花了我最长时间的地方。下面上代码
# ========================================================
# Summary        :run
# Author         :tong shan
# Create Date    :2015-10-09
# Amend History  :
# Amended by     :
# ========================================================
import readConfig
readConfigLocal = readConfig.ReadConfig()
import unittest
from testSet.common.DRIVER import myDriver
import testSet.common.Log as Log
import os
from time import sleep
from selenium.common.exceptions import WebDriverException
import threading
mylock = threading.RLock()
log = Log.myLog.getLog()
# ========================================================
# Summary        :myServer
# Author         :tong shan
# Create Date    :2015-10-10
# Amend History  :
# Amended by     :
# ========================================================
class myServer(threading.Thread):
    def __init__(self):
        global appiumPath
        threading.Thread.__init__(self)
        self.appiumPath = readConfigLocal.getConfigValue("appiumPath")
    def run(self):
        log.outputLogFile("start appium server")
        rootDirectory = self.appiumPath[:2]
        startCMD = "node node_modules\\appium\\bin\\appium.js"
        #cd root directory ;cd appiuu path; start server
        os.system(rootDirectory+"&"+"cd "+self.appiumPath+"&"+startCMD)
# ========================================================
# Summary        :Alltest
# Author         :tong shan
# Create Date    :2015-10-10
# Amend History  :
# Amended by     :
# ========================================================
class Alltest(threading.Thread):
    def __init__(self):
        threading.Thread.__init__(self)
        global casePath, caseListLpath, caseList, suiteList, appiumPath
        self.caseListPath = readConfig.logDir+"\\caseList.txt"
        self.casePath = readConfig.logDir+"\\testSet\\"
        self.caseList = []
        self.suiteList = []
        self.appiumPath = readConfigLocal.getConfigValue("appiumPath")
# =================================================================
# Function Name   : driverOn
# Function        : open the driver
# Input Parameters: -
# Return Value    : -
# =================================================================
    def driverOn(self):
        myDriver.GetDriver()
# =================================================================
# Function Name   : driverOff
# Function        : colse the driver
# Input Parameters: -
# Return Value    : -
# =================================================================
    def driverOff(self):
        myDriver.GetDriver().quit()
# =================================================================
# Function Name   : setCaseList
# Function        : read caseList.txt and set caseList
# Input Parameters: -
# Return Value    : -
# =================================================================
    def setCaseList(self):
        print(self.caseListPath)
        fp = open(self.caseListPath)
        for data in fp.readlines():
            sData = str(data)
            if sData != '' and not sData.startswith("#"):
                self.caseList.append(sData)
# =================================================================
# Function Name   : createSuite
# Function        : get testCase in caseList
# Input Parameters: -
# Return Value    : testSuite
# =================================================================
    def createSuite(self):
        self.setCaseList()
        testSuite = unittest.TestSuite()
        if len(self.caseList) > 0:
            for caseName in self.caseList:
                discover = unittest.defaultTestLoader.discover(self.casePath, pattern=caseName+'.py', top_level_dir=None)
                self.suiteList.append(discover)
        if len(self.suiteList) > 0:
            for test_suite in self.suiteList:
                for casename in test_suite:
                    testSuite.addTest(casename)
        else:
            return None
        return testSuite
# =================================================================
# Function Name   : runTest
# Function        : run test
# Input Parameters: -
# Return Value    : -
# =================================================================
    def run(self):
        try:
            while not isStartServer():
                mylock.acquire()
                sleep(1)
                log.outputLogFile("wait 1s to start appium server")
                mylock.release()
            else:
                log.outputLogFile("start appium server success")
                suit = self.createSuite()
                if suit != None:
                    log.outputLogFile("open Driver")
                    self.driverOn()
                    log.outputLogFile("Start to test")
                    unittest.TextTestRunner(verbosity=2).run(suit)
                    log.outputLogFile("end to test")
                    log.outputLogFile("close to Driver")
                    self.driverOff()
                else:
                    log.outputLogFile("Have no test to run")
        except Exception as ex:
            log.outputError(myDriver.GetDriver(), str(ex))
def isStartServer():
    try:
        driver = myDriver.GetDriver()
        if driver == None:
            return False
        else:
            return True
    except WebDriverException:
        raise
if __name__ == '__main__':
    thread1 = myServer()
    thread2 = Alltest()
    thread2.start()
    thread1.start()
    while thread2.is_alive():
        sleep(10)#"allTest is alive,sleep10"
    else:
        #kill myServer
        os.system('taskkill /f /im node.exe')
        log.outputLogFile("stop appium server")
思路
刚接触的时候发现每次都要手动打开 appium 服务,然后再运行代码,想着是不是太麻烦了?就想试着可不可做成一步?
 这一想,就费了我好多功夫。
 1.打开 appium server
 开始的时候,连如何用命令行打开服务都不会,在群里问了一圈(感谢回答问题的大大们!!!),然后自己又琢磨了一下,搞定了,可是!!!用 os.system(),居然阻塞进程,最后还是问了群里的大大解决(再次感谢!!!!)。
 2.如何判断 server 是否被成功开启?
 这个问题我想了很久,现在我解决了,但是解决方法我不太满意,希望有大大可以给我一个好点的方法或者思路(跪谢!!)
 目前做法:判断是否可以返回一个正常的 driver 对象
def isStartServer():
    try:
        driver = myDriver.GetDriver()
        if driver == None:
            return False
        else:
            return True
    except WebDriverException:
        raise
3.关闭 appium server
目前的做法是强制杀死,还是不太满意,不知道以后会不会有什么不可预见的问题,希望有大大可以给我一个好点的方法或者思路(跪谢!!)
if __name__ == '__main__':
    thread1 = myServer()
    thread2 = Alltest()
    thread2.start()
    thread1.start()
    while thread2.is_alive():
        sleep(10)#"allTest is alive,sleep10"
    else:
        #kill myServer
        os.system('taskkill /f /im node.exe')
        log.outputLogFile("stop appium server")
其他模块
1.common.py 共同方法,主要指封装了一些方法,供其他模块使用。
 2.DRIVER.py 获取 driver,这里是做成了一个单例模式,run.py 中打开,关闭,其他模块调用。
 3.Log.py 中有 2 个类 log 和 myLog,同样也把 myLog 做成了一个单例模式
 4.myPhone.py 主要使用了 adb 命令来识别和获取手机参数
 5.readConfig.py 是读取配置文件
